Sorts Of Air Solutions Available



A variety of air systems are readily available to meet varied requirements throughout household, business, and commercial settings. Amongst the most common kinds are air conditioning systems, which offer detailed environment control via a network of ducts. These systems are optimal for bigger rooms, guaranteeing constant temperature and air high quality.


Ductless mini-split systems supply a versatile choice, enabling for targeted cooling and home heating in certain zones without the requirement for ductwork. This is specifically useful in older buildings or for enhancements where duct installation might not be practical.


For commercial applications, roof systems (RTUs) are widespread. These self-contained systems offer efficient home heating, cooling, and air flow and are designed for sturdiness popular settings.


Furthermore, evaporative coolers take advantage of the natural procedure of dissipation to cool down air, making them a cost-efficient alternative in completely dry climates. Portable air conditioning system provide versatility for temporary cooling options, ideal for areas that need flexibility or are not equipped with irreversible systems.

Maintenance and Upkeep Tips



Normal maintenance and maintenance are important for guaranteeing ideal efficiency and long life of air systems. To accomplish this, it is crucial to establish a routine maintenance schedule that includes filter replacements, cleansing, and system examinations. Air filters need to be examined regular monthly and changed every three months, or a lot more often in dirty settings, to preserve air flow effectiveness and indoor air quality.


In addition, routine cleaning of the evaporator and condenser coils can protect against getting too hot and boost power efficiency. Ensure that the condensate drainpipe is clear to prevent water damage and mold and mildew development. Check ductwork for leakages or blockages, which can significantly lower system effectiveness.


Professional inspections ought to be conducted at the very least yearly to recognize prospective issues early and make sure compliance with safety and security criteria. During these examinations, professionals can likewise adjust thermostats and check cooling agent degrees.
